House Manager/Head Housekeeper £70,000 – £100,000 DOE - Central London

Seeking Ex-Yachting Professionals! This job has huge progression! We are seeking a highly skilled, ex-yachting House Manager/Head Housekeeper to take charge of a brand-new luxury residence in London, owned by international VIP clients accustomed to the highest standards of service.

This is a unique opportunity for a proactive and polished individual to step into a key leadership role.

You will initially assist with daily Head Housekeeping duties while overseeing and managing a team of 3 housekeepers. As the household becomes fully operational, you will transition into a full House Manager role — responsible for the smooth running of the residence and maintaining a yacht-level standard of service throughout.

Requirements for the Role:
  • Experience in high-end private households (1–2 years preferred)
  • Strong background in yachting (essential)
  • Impeccable attention to detail and service mindset
  • Highly organised, discreet, and well-presented
  • Proven ability to manage, train and lead a small team
  • Ability to liaise with principals and external service providers with professionalism
Ideal suitable for:
  • A Junior House Manager, Head Housekeeper, or Head of Residence Operations professional transitioning from yachting to land-based private service
  • Someone seeking a long-term position with excellent growth potential.

Amazing opportunity to take real ownership of a large London house, progressing into a managerial role.

Paying up to £100K
